RIYADH: US and Israeli strikes on Iran led to widespread airspace shutdowns in the Middle East, canceling and rerouting thousands of flights and paralyzing key international travel corridors. Flight cancellations affected seven airports across the Middle East, including Dubai and Abu Dhabi in the UAE, Doha in Qatar, and Manama in Bahrain.

CNBC's team in the United Arab Emirates confirmed hearing a number of loud explosions in both the UAE's capital city of Abu Dhabi and Dubai.

BA, Virgin Atlantic and Wizz Air are among major airlines to overhaul their schedules in light of the attacks.
